Perkins Cemetery
Perkins Cemetery is a cemetery in Town of Winterport, Waldo County, Maine.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Newburgh is a town in Penobscot County, Maine, United States. The population was 1,595 at the time of the 2020 census. Newburgh is situated 4½ miles northwest of Perkins Cemetery.

Monroe is a town in Waldo County, Maine, United States named for President James Monroe. The population was 931 at the 2020 census. Monroe is situated 5 miles southwest of Perkins Cemetery.

Frankfort is a town on the Penobscot River estuary in Waldo County, Maine, United States. The population was 1,231 at the 2020 census. Frankfort is situated 5 miles southeast of Perkins Cemetery.
